WebThe peripheral afferent nervous system also appears to be implicated in the pathogenesis of RLS [6]. In a study of 22 patients with RLS without risk factors for neuropathy (DM, B12 deficiency, uremia, or alcohol use disorder), 33% (8/22) had neuropathy and five of those had biopsy-proven small-fiber neuropathy [7].
